Job description

Facilities Fire Assistant
Permanent, full time
Drax Power Station, Selby
Onsite

Closing date: Monday 4th August 2025

Do you thrive in a fast-paced environment where no two days are the same? Ifyou’relooking for a hands-onpracticalrole that keeps a business ticking, then thisFacilities Fire Assistantrole at Drax could be the perfect fit for you.

Who we are


We’renot just talking about making a difference,we’remaking it happen. We generate dispatchable, renewable power and create stable energy in an uncertain world. Building on our proud heritage, we have ambition to become the global leader in sustainable biomass and carbon removals.

You’llbe joining our teams of practical doers, futurethinkersand business champions.We’reworking hard to decarbonise the planet for generations to come.

About the role

As part of theFacilitiesTeam,you’ll provideessential process, analytical, and administrative support to ensure the continuoussafetyand maintenance of our buildings and surrounding areas at Drax Power Station.

Your role will be crucial insupporting the maintenance of portable fire extinguishersas part ofmaintaininga safe environment for all colleagues, contractors and visitorson site.

You’llwork closely with the Facilities Manager andtheDrax Fire Technician,assistingin compliance, maintenance, and coordination of essential site operationsand other tasks as part of the team.

Whowe’relooking for

To be successful in this roleyou’llbedetail-oriented, proactive and passionate aboutmaintaininga safe and efficient working environment.

You’ll demonstrate a keen interest in developing your career in facilities management. Knowledge of basic fire regulations would be a plus, but full training will be provided.

The successful candidate will have strong Microsoft Office skills and further experience with Maximo is ideal.

This role requires great communication skills, as you’llbe engaging with teams at all levels, including our Senior Leadership Team. You’ll be a problem solver with the ability to work under pressure and meet deadlines.
